The Pacolet Diesel Generation Facility is a 5.4 MW peaking power plant located in Spartanburg County, South Carolina. The plant began operating in 2006 and is owned and operated by Lockhart Power Co. It consists of three generators utilizing petroleum liquids as their primary fuel source.
The plant operates within the Duke Energy Carolinas balancing authority and the SERC NERC region. According to available data, the Pacolet Diesel Generation Facility ranks 9th out of 14 similar plants in South Carolina and 526th nationally out of 886. Financial data indicates an installed cost of $339.57 per kilowatt, as reported to FERC.

This plant's balancing authority participates in the Southeast Energy Exchange Market (SEEM). SEEM is a bilateral exchange — no public nodal pricing.
No wholesale contracts disclosed in FERC EQR for this plant.
FERC EQR captures bilateral wholesale energy + capacity contracts ≥$1M/yr filed quarterly by jurisdictional sellers — covers renewable PPAs, thermal energy sales agreements, capacity contracts, and tolling agreements alike. Many plants don't appear: regulated-utility output flows to ratepayers via cost-of-service rather than bilateral contracts; small projects fall below the filing threshold; tax-equity-financed renewables route offtake to investors not utilities; merchant plants sell into ISO clearing markets without bilateral contracts.
